Adaptive reuse at the heart of campus

The former campus central heating plant has recently reopened as the new home of the Gregory J. Grappone Humanities Institute. The prominent location between Alumni Hall —the college’s original building — and the college’s new welcome center provides an opportunity to highlight both a charming historic building and the central importance of the humanities to the institution.

The design transforms the existing elevated level and cavernous basement below into flexible classrooms as well as collaborative community space. The new site design and entrance highlight features of the existing building and enliven this area of campus. Over the course of four years, Placework worked with Saint Anselm leadership and faculty to develop the program, conceptual design, and budget to assess the feasibility and support fundraising. We provided full architectural and interior design, including coordination of all furnishings.
